Power Characteristic Variation Simulation of Hybrid Electric Propulsion System for Small UAV (소형 무인기용 하이브리드 전기추진시스템 전력 특성변화 시뮬레이션)

  • Lee, Bo-Hwa;Park, Poo-Min;Kim, Chun-Taek;Yang, Soo-Seok;Ahn, Seok-Min
    • Journal of the Korean Society for Aeronautical & Space Sciences
    • /
    • v.39 no.11
    • /
    • pp.1052-1059
    • /
    • 2011
  • It is conducted that power characteristic variation simulation of electric propulsion system that uses fuel cells, solar cells and a battery as power sources. Combining each power source, 400W electric propulsion system have been modeled and verified. In result, without active control logic, it is confirmed that battery's power response is faster than other power sources at starting and transient condition, fuel cell and solar cell are a major electrical power during cruise condition. After completing flight, SOC is 24.2% at the winter solstice and is 93% at the summer solstice, It is revealed that active power control for sustaining proper SOC is necessary as a securing the system safety and effective power distribution.

A Study on the Fault Tolerant Control System for Aircraft Sensor and Actuator Failures via Neural Networks (신경회로망을 이용한 항공기 센서 및 구동장치 고장보완 제어시스템 설계에 관한 연구)

  • Song, Yong Kyu
    • Journal of Advanced Navigation Technology
    • /
    • v.7 no.2
    • /
    • pp.171-179
    • /
    • 2003
  • In this paper a neural network-based fault tolerant control system for aircraft sensor and actuator failures is considered. By exploiting flight dynamic relations a set of neural networks is constructed to detect sensor failure and give alternative signal for the faulty sensor. For actuator failures another set of neural networks is designed to perform fault detection, identification, and accomodation which returns the aircraft to a new stable trim. Integrated system is simulated to show the performance of the system with sensor and control surface failures.

Particle Filters using Gaussian Mixture Models for Vision-Based Navigation (영상 기반 항법을 위한 가우시안 혼합 모델 기반 파티클 필터)

  • Hong, Kyungwoo;Kim, Sungjoong;Bang, Hyochoong;Kim, Jin-Won;Seo, Ilwon;Pak, Chang-Ho
    • Journal of the Korean Society for Aeronautical & Space Sciences
    • /
    • v.47 no.4
    • /
    • pp.274-282
    • /
    • 2019
  • Vision-based navigation of unmaned aerial vehicle is a significant technology that can reinforce the vulnerability of the widely used GPS/INS integrated navigation system. However, the existing image matching algorithms are not suitable for matching the aerial image with the database. For the reason, this paper proposes particle filters using Gaussian mixture models to deal with matching between aerial image and database for vision-based navigation. The particle filters estimate the position of the aircraft by comparing the correspondences of aerial image and database under the assumption of Gaussian mixture model. Finally, Monte Carlo simulation is presented to demonstrate performance of the proposed method.

Feasibility Study on the Methodology of Test and Evaluation for UAV Positioning (무인항공기 위치정확도 시험평가 기법 연구)

  • Ju, Yo-han;Moon, Kyung-kwan;Kang, Bong-seok;Jeong, Jae-won;Son, Han-gi;Cho, Jeong-hyun
    • Journal of Advanced Navigation Technology
    • /
    • v.22 no.6
    • /
    • pp.530-536
    • /
    • 2018
  • Recently, many studies for interoperability of UAV in the NAS has been performed since the application range and demand of UAV are continuously increased. For the interoperation of UAV in the NAS, technical standards and certification system for UAV which is equivalent to the commercial aircraft are required and test and evaluation methodology must be presented by standards. In this paper, qualification test and evaluation methodology aboutfor the UAV navigation system is proposed. For the research, the mission profile and operation environment of UAV were analyzed. Thereafter the test criteria were derived and the test methodology were established. Finally, the simulation and demonstration using test-bed UAV were performed. As a result of the test, it was confirmed that the navigation system of test UAV has a position accuracy about 1.4 meters at 95% confidence level in the entire flight stage.
